Simpson Thacher Represents KKR in Acquisition of Prisma Capital Partners

The Firm is representing KKR & Co. L.P. in its acquisition of Prisma Capital Partners LP, a leading provider of customized hedge fund solutions. Prisma is known for identifying specialist hedge fund managers with exceptional track records and creating custom portfolios for clients. As of April 1, 2012, Prisma had $7.8 billion in assets under management, with more than 90% belonging to institutional investors. The transaction is expected to close in the fourth quarter 2012.

Kramer Levin Represents Joint Venture of Toll Brothers and Starwood Capital Group in Connection with Winning Bid to Develop Pier 1 in Brooklyn Bridge Park

Kramer Levin represented a joint venture of Toll Brothers and Starwood Capital Group in connection with its winning bid for and negotiation of a 97-year ground lease to develop a new $300 million hotel and residential complex that will be built next to Pier 1, just south of the Brooklyn Bridge in Brooklyn Bridge Park, a 1.3-mile-long park which stretches along the East River on the Brooklyn waterfront. The development will include approximately 200 hotel rooms, 160 condominium apartments, 32,000 square feet of restaurant and banquet space, a 6,000-square-foot spa and a 300 space parking facility. The deal was approved by the Brooklyn Bridge Park Corporation’s Board on Tuesday, June 19.

Eckert Seamans Adds Former White House Senior Policy Advisor to Intellectual Property Practice

Jennifer Choe Groves has joined the Washington, DC office of Eckert Seamans Cherin & Mellott, LLC as a Member and Vice Chair of the firm’s Intellectual Property Group for Enforcement and Entertainment. Her practice is focused on trademark and copyright matters, international trade policy, IP rights protection and enforcement, as well as anti-counterfeiting and anti-piracy work. She advocates for clients from a wide array of business sectors, including biotechnology, pharmaceuticals, entertainment, media, high technology, retail, and luxury and household goods, among others.

Shearman & Sterling Advises Aurora Solar Corporation in Acquisition of Nine Generating Facilities

Shearman & Sterling advised Aurora Solar Corporation (a joint venture comprised of, among others, Osaka Gas Co., Ltd. and Mitsubishi Corporation) as purchaser of nine photovoltaic (pv) generating facilities in Ontario, Canada. The sponsors were advised by Mizuho Corporate Bank, Ltd. as financial advisor and Stikeman Elliott as Canadian counsel.

Davis Polk Advises Vector Capital on the Acquisition of Quest Software

Davis Polk is advising Vector Capital on the $2.2 billion leveraged buyout of Quest Software, Inc. Joining with CEO Vincent Smith and Insight Venture Partners, on June 19, 2012, Vector Capital entered into definitive agreements to acquire Quest for $25.75 per share in cash. The transaction is also being financed with approximately $1.2 billion of debt financing commitments from J.P. Morgan Chase Bank N.A., RBC Capital Markets and Barclays Capital.
